In AI data centers, the number of ports available within a rack often matters more than transmission distance. ALT Group's 800G OSFP VR8 transceiver module is purpose-built for exactly this kind of high-density, short-reach connectivity.
The module integrates two independent optical links, allowing a single port to handle two data paths at once — effectively saving rack space and improving overall port efficiency. Combined with a cross-vendor compatible form factor, it interoperates smoothly with switches and NICs from different brands, whatever their origin, significantly reducing integration complexity in mixed-vendor environments.

Three practical advantages of the 800G OSFP VR8:
- Dual-port-in-one design: Two independent 4-channel optical links built into a single module, doubling connection efficiency within the same slot footprint — ideal for high-density intra-row or intra-rack switch-to-server cabling.
- Cross-vendor plug-and-play: Interoperable with OSFP switches and NICs across vendors, freeing enterprises from single-supplier lock-in and adding flexibility to procurement and scaling.
- Hot-swappable without downtime: Install or replace modules without powering down the switch, reducing operational risk and downtime.
Typical applications include:
- AI server rack interconnects: Broadly compatible with servers from NVIDIA, AMD, and other leading vendors, meeting the high-bandwidth needs within AI training and inference clusters.
- High-density switching architectures: Suited for data center designs that need to fit more ports into limited space.
- Short-reach multimode fiber cabling: Covers typical intra-row and intra-rack switch-to-server connection distances, keeping cabling costs manageable.
